Overview
What it actually does
ABC See, Hear, Do pairs each letter sound with a memorable picture and physical action, then moves children into blending consonant-vowel-consonant words through books, cards, worksheets, and games. The gesture system can unlock letter-sound recall for young or kinesthetic learners, but the program is best treated as an early phonics bridge rather than a complete, multi-year structured-literacy sequence.
Quality
Who it suits—and the catch
Parents and speech-language professionals like the simple sound-plus-action memory hook, particularly when a child is not retaining letter sounds from ordinary flashcards. Experienced homeschoolers typically use it before or alongside a fuller program such as All About Reading, because decodable progression, spelling, morphology, and later fluency need more depth.
- full bundle is expensive
- scope is narrower than a complete reading curriculum
- gestures may not suit every learner
- many components can be unnecessary if one book solves the problem

State evidence
Where the underlying expense category may qualify
Category permission, provider approval and exact-SKU approval are separate questions.
Arizona
Empowerment Scholarship Account
Curriculum, textbooks, workbooks, and instructional materials are eligible.
